Regular maintenance, including flushing and pressure testing, is a cornerstone of Pittsburgh water heater naturally. By performing these tasks, you can prevent mineral buildup, ensure optimal temperature regulation, and reduce energy consumption. For instance, flushes remove sediment that can clog heating elements or pipes, while pressure tests identify potential leaks early on. The best temperature for a Pittsburgh water heater is typically set between 120-140°F (49-60°C). This range ensures hot water availability while preventing excessive heating, which can lead to energy waste. A temperature of around 135°F (57°C) is often considered ideal as it strikes a balance between comfort and efficiency. Regular replacement is another vital aspect of efficient heating. Most Pittsburgh water heaters last between 8-12 years, depending on usage and maintenance. Plumber Marlborough, MA experts suggest replacing your water heater if it’s older than this or shows signs of deterioration. Early indications may include inconsistent hot water supply, increased energy bills, or visible corrosion. Regular maintenance involves several key practices. First and foremost, ensuring proper ventilation is vital, especially in the confined spaces of a typical Pittsburgh home. A well-ventilated water heater prevents the buildup of dangerous carbon monoxide and enhances overall efficiency. Second, scheduling professional inspections annually or every two years can catch potential issues early on. Pittsburgh’s cold winters necessitate thorough check-ups to prepare for extreme temperatures. During these visits, experts can assess for rust, leaks, and other problems, providing valuable insights into your unit’s health.
Moreover, keeping the area around your water heater clear of debris and moisture is essential. A dry, well-insulated space allows for efficient heat transfer and reduces energy waste. Pittsburgh residents should also consider insulating their water heaters, especially older models, to prevent heat loss during cold months. According to recent reviews in 2023, many Pittsburghers have reported significant energy savings after installing proper insulation. Lastly, regular flushing can remove sediment buildup, a common issue in hard water areas like Pittsburgh, thereby improving heating performance and extending the heater’s lifespan.
